COVID-19: Nigeria Approves Reopening Of NYSC Orientation Camps
The Federal Government has announced the reopening of all camps where the National Youth Service Corps (NYSC) orientation exercises across the country hold on November 10.
The approval was made known via social media on Thursday October 15 by the Minister of Youths and Sports, Sunday Dare.
“The Resumption of the NYSC Orientation Camp for prospective Youth Corpers has been approved and opens on November 10th 2020,” he wrote on Twitter. “Full COVID-19 Protocols will be enforced.”
The Federal Government had ordered the closure of the NYSC orientation camps nationwide over coronavirus fears on March 18.
